Hi Aerolet , can I say I had the same issue and only on DCS , other graphic intense games were fine .In my  case I switched my PSU (in fact I took a gamble a went for the same model) as I had got to the end of  the updating , installing , clearing cache , verifying  etc . I was actually going  to basically totally upgrade my PC and I started with the PSU as it was the cheapest component! I was lucky .  If you are suffering  a power off  crash and your PC is  not very new it may be worth trying  that ! If it crashes to desktop it probably is something  else but as the others has said in that case you may be able to get a crash report .
